Understanding Homeownership Costs in Gulf Shores

When purchasing a home in Gulf Shores, Alabama, your mortgage principal and interest payment is only part of the equation. "PITI" (Principal, Interest, Taxes, and Insurance) forms the baseline of your required monthly payment to your lender, but true homeownership involves additional carrying costs.

For a median priced home of $331,300 in Gulf Shores, buyers must budget for recurring property taxes (estimated at $947/year), state-adjusted homeowners insurance, and ongoing physical maintenance. Furthermore, the upfront cash required for a down payment carries an "opportunity cost"—the potential investment return that money could have earned elsewhere.

Property Taxes & Insurance

Property taxes in Gulf Shores push the effective tax rate to approximately 0.29%. Combined with geographic insurance risks specific to Alabama, these non-negotiable expenses form a significant portion of your monthly escrow requirement.

Maintenance Burden

Applying the standard 1.0% rule to Gulf Shores's median home values means you should budget approximately $3,313 annually to protect your investment from structural degradation.

Local Affordability

How it compares to local earnings

Financial advisors generally recommend the "28/36 rule" — spending no more than 28% of your gross monthly income on housing expenses, and no more than 36% on total debt.

In Gulf Shores, the median household income is $62,021. Based on current rates and median home prices, the total monthly ownership burden represents approximately 48.3% of the median household's gross income.
